Chain-weighted price indices are constructed such that:
A. prices in different economies can be directly compared with one another.
B. prices in different years can be directly compared with one another.
C. all years' levels of GDP are directly related to a base year level of GDP.
D. prices of one good can be directly compared with prices of other goods.
Answer: B
